  Publié: 2015-07-09, Auteur: Alex , review by: cadalyst.com

  • Unique form factor, innovative thermal design, top-end single-thread performance with overclocked, liquid-cooled Core i7, top-end rendering performance with NVIDIA Quadro K5200, plenty of spare cables and adapters included
  • SATA SSD rather than PCIExpress SSD, low PSU wattage, side panels easy to dislodge and could potentially compromise cooling/reliability, awkward cabling with top-panel I/O and bottom power, top-access vulnerable to spills or debris
  • If you're building workstations and your name isn't HP, Dell, or Lenovo, then you should create machines that none of those three would think to build. And on that fundamental strategy, Maingear has succeeded.There's no point in a smaller vendor trying to...

  Publié: 2012-05-18, Auteur: Rich , review by: cnet.com

  • The Maingear F131 comes in an attractive, surprisingly roomy chassis, and it posted some of the fastest gaming performance to grace CNET Labs.
  • The $3,000 price tag puts this desktop out of reach for all but the most enthusiastic PC gamers.
  • If you're in the market for a $3,000 gaming PC, the attractive, blazing fast Maingear F131 should be first on your list.
